Summary: The Research Assistant (Voices of Motherhood) role is a part-time position within the History & Sociology department at City Campus. The position involves supporting research initiatives focused on the experiences of motherhood. The salary range for this role is between £26,707 and £30,378 annually. The role requires a commitment of 14 hours per week.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Assist in research projects related to motherhood.
  • Support data collection and analysis.
  • Contribute to the preparation of research reports and publications.
  • Engage with participants and stakeholders as needed.

Key Skills:

  • Strong research and analytical skills.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ication abilities.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
  • Experience in qualitative and quantitative research methods.
